Localized microdontia describes a single tooth that’s smaller than usual or smaller compared to neighboring teeth. There are several subtypes of this type of microdontia, too: 1. microdontia of the tooth’s root 2. microdontia of the crown 3. microdontia of the whole tooth The localized version is the most … See more True generalized is the rarest kind of microdontia. It typically affects people who have a condition like pituitary dwarfismand results in a set of uniformly smaller … See more Someone with relatively large jaws or a protruding jaw might receive a diagnosis of relative generalized microdontia. The key here is “relative,” since the size of the … See more WebDec 27, 2024 · Tooth crowding is caused by teeth that are too large or a jaw that is too small. Some people have both problems.
